Do not have it trimmed. To trim it they will run a razor over the clearbra to cut it and then take it off... imagine if they cut too deeply... if they did that half assed a job installing it, imagine how bad it would be trying to cut it.
The clear bra should NOT overlap at all.
There should NOT be any particles under the clearbra...
Some bubbling will disappear after a couple days.
Honestly, the fact that it overlaps, and the edges do not line up... i would be very disatisfied.
Have them remove and get it done somwehre else.
